What happened to ING Direct accounts?

According to an email sent to customers, ING Direct will become Capital One 360. The move follows Capital One’s acquisition of ING Direct USA, the largest direct bank in the country, last June. In addition to the name change, ING’s orange will be replaced by dark blue and maroon.

Is ING Direct still around?

ING DIRECT has officially been converted to Capital One 360. ING Direct’s website at ingdirect.com now redirects users to CapitalOne360.com.

How do I withdraw money from Orange?

To withdraw cash from your account:

  1. Visit an Orange shop or an authorized point of sales.
  2. Provide the agent with your phone number.
  3. Receive the confirmation request SMS on your mobile phone.
  4. Dial *149# and press ‘send’ or ‘call’
  5. When prompted, confirm the transaction with your secret code and press ‘send’ or ‘call’

Who took over ING DIRECT?

Capital One
In February 2012, Capital One acquired ING Direct USA from ING for US$6.3 billion in cash and 54 million shares of Capital One.

Is ING Direct part of Barclays?

On 6 March 2013 ING Direct UK savings accounts and mortgages transferred to Barclays Bank. A new Barclays brand, Barclays Direct, will now look after these accounts.
